I currently own an MX-700. It does everything I want and well. I'm just bored of it. I really want something with a color touch screen. I'm very happy with my MX-700 so I first looked at the Universal Remote remotes, even though I would have to buy from an authorized dealer. I got my MX-700 from some shady place in Brooklyn for $200 so needless to say my auto update isn't working any more. I looked at the MX-3000, but it was crazy expensive and it looks like a $5 Tiger Electronics video game. I then looked at the iPronto. Also very expensive, and its huge. I might as well use my old laptop as a remote. I also looked at the Pronto TSU7500. I was real close to getting that, but it was still really expensive, but less than the others. My wife drops the remote on our non-carpeted floors all the time so spending $800 on a remote was probably out of the question. Then I saw the 9800i and loved the look of it. I was like wow a Pronto for around $300. It looks awesome, what's the catch? Then I started reading this forum and quickly realised it wasn't a Pronto and you couldn't even customize it from the computer or really customize it at all. First I was like F that, I'm outta here. Then I just lowered my expectations. If you look at it like a Pronto, you will be vastly dissapointed. But if you look at it like a Logitech Harmony remote, it starts looking much better. I figure as long as it can learn any button and do the basic switching of inputs on my TV and Stereo, I'll be ok. I still have my MX-700 that I can use to tech this thing any discrete or other commands it doesn't know. I'll let everyone know what I think about the remote after I receive it and play with it. I'm going to try and be more opened minded so we'll see!
